Output 35160b96acf491d71c045faeee41ee3895df461cffa13affe4a83ce9199e21e0:1

value
580981
script pubkey
OP_0 OP_PUSHBYTES_20 577ee8bb30b8fcf18eb9bec7c5383f483a564fb3
address
bc1q2alw3weshr70rr4ehmru2wplfqa9vnana04jk8
transaction
35160b96acf491d71c045faeee41ee3895df461cffa13affe4a83ce9199e21e0